Abstract :
The paper proposes a simple and practical method for improving the performance of DSP-controlled active power filters (AF). The transfer function of a DSP-controlled AF has a phase-lag property because there is calculation time delay in the control output, which causes a serious deterioration in the AF performance. In the proposed system, an adaptive digital filter (ADF) operates as a series compensator and compensates for the time-lag property of AF. The ADF requires no additional hardware, but for only a slight additional software. It was confirmed by simulation and experimental results that simple two-tap ADF is very effective for improving the AF compensation performance
